A Practice Wife is defined as; a woman who a man dates right before he settles down with someone else, and Misha London has had three exes, who within months of breaking up with her, got married. Misha, the only daughter of religious parents, cleaned up Carson Rivers for two years, improving him from head to toe, forgiving his bad sides and focusing on his good sides. And just like two of her former boyfriends, Carson is getting married. But instead of getting married within a year or even a month of breaking up, Carson is getting married the very next day, and Misha finds out on Facebook. At 44 years old, Misha is devastated. She yearns to be married with children, and has even gone through the process of freezing her eggs. Will she no longer be the bridesmaid, not wife material, destined to be what her best friend calls, happily single? Maybe that wouldn’t be so bad after all. But then, in walks handsome, single father, Dr. Devonta Hill.

Mahogany Cooper’s broken heart is literally killing her. She doesn’t believe she can survive the breakup of her marriage. She’s unable to work, eat, sleep, and breathe. Her husband of seven years, Julian Cooper, has left her for his friend named Golden Thomas. Mahogany is devastated and feels as though the best remedy would be for Julian to simply come back to her. She believes that’s the only way to stop the pain. But both her best friend and her sister insist that she must face the pain that’s causing her depression, and detox from the man whom she says she cannot live without. Will Mahogany survive losing her love, or will a broken heart be too much for her, and for him, to bear?

Your boyfriend’s mother prefers his ex over you. What would you do? Your man’s ex-wife is in town and wants to stay with him for the weekend. Would you be okay with that? You see your brother-in-law at the movie theatre holding hands with another woman. Do you tell your sister? For five years, bestselling author Marissa Monteilh has posted original relationship questions on her social media pages. Thousands of responses to her creative questions have generated controversial debates. The Mind of a Woman is a compilation of those posts, as the top 365 relationship scenario questions were selected for this fun, and interactive non-fiction book. Male and female readers will enjoy discussing these topics during book club meetings, family gatherings, office parties, etc., and readers will test their own relationship boundaries privately. Find out what your friends would do. After all, the mind of a woman is a beautiful and complicated thing. It may surprise you!

The good doctor, Dr. Makkai Worthy, returns as Dr. Feelgood in the steamy sequel of a handsome, popular heart surgeon who repairs hearts in his professional life, yet breaks them in his personal life. Dr. Makkai Worthy’s daughter Fonda is now five-years old, and her mother, Monday Askins, who abandoned Fonda after giving birth, is back, and she vows to make good on her threat to get her daughter if it’s the last thing she does. Dr. Feelgood is unattached after his split from Mary Jane Cherry, and his life-saving hands are full, as his love of women again rules his rolling stone life. But one sequence of dramatic events leads to another, and if Dr. Feelgood plans to save himself, he’ll need to break the generational curses that bind and face some unexpected truths. Will his love of women continue to rule his world, or will he break all the rules and prove to himself, that having it bad, ain’t good?
